Beginners
Our winter beginner program starts in October and runs through February.
Our spring beginner program starts in April and runs through July.
Players may join at any time on a space available basis.
Kids ages 5 through 10 have the opportunity to learn the game of hockey.
They will learn how to skate, handle a puck with a stick, and many other valuable life skills.

What do I get for Equipment Rental?
Each player is required to wear full gear. Rental equipment is available
for $50. Gear available for rent consists of the following:
• Skates
• Knee Pads
• Hockey Pants
• Shoulder Pads
• Elbow Pads
• Helmet
Additional equipment that is required but is not available
for rent is:
• Socks
• Jersey
• Cup
• Stick
